Gerald Van Harris, 88, of Van Buren, passed away Friday, July 19, 2024 in Barling. He was born May 26, 1936 in Cedarville to the late Elzie and Myrtle (Maxey) Harris. He was a mortician and had worked for Edwards Funeral Home in Fort Smith and retired from Edwards Van-Alma Funeral Home in Van Buren. He was a founding member of Concord Baptist Church and the District 6 Rural Fire Department, and instrumental in establishing Evergreen Cemetery in Alma. He was a member of Butterfield Church, sat on the board of Stepping Stone School, was a lifetime member of Gideons International, and was a volunteer firefighter.
In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by his wife, Margaret S. Harris; and many siblings.
He is survived a daughter, Melody Harris of Van Buren; a son, Robert Harris and wife Fawn of Van Buren; a grand-dog, Hope Sue Harris; and many more friends and family members.
